The California Supreme Court has ruled that landlords who participate in government-subsidized tenancies (most commonly, Section 8 tenancies) must give tenants a 90 Day Eviction Notice when terminating tenancies without cause. Landlord's Obligations: The role of the landlord in the voucher program is to provide decent, safe, and sanitary housing to a tenant at a reasonable rent. The landlord must explain why he or she is asking the tenant to move out, and the landlord must have good reasons ("just cause") to ask the tenant to leave. The terminology can get confusing. The state of California does not administer Section 8 rental programs. The dwelling unit must pass the program's housing quality standards and be maintained up to those standards as long as the owner receives housing assistance payments. In an effort to help remedy California’s housing affordability crisis, a law taking effect Jan. 1 bars landlords from discriminating against low-income renters with Section 8 vouchers..
